Lens and retina regeneration: transdifferentiation, stem cells and clinical applications
Panagiotis A Tsonis1, Katia Del Rio-Tsonis
1University of Dayton, Laboratory of Molecular Biology, Department of Biology, Dayton, OH 45469-2320, USA. panagiotis.tsonis@notes.udayton.edu
Abstract:
In this review we present a synthesis on the potential of vertebrate eye tissue regeneration, such as lens and retina. Particular emphasis is given to two different strategies used for regeneration, transdifferentiation and stem cells. Similarities and differences between these two strategies are outlined and it is proposed that both strategies might follow common pathways. Furthermore, we elaborate on specific clinical applications as the outcome of regeneration-based research.
